		<description>If you're selling Macbook1...boot off the installation dvd, by inserting the DVD and turning on the macbook while holding down the "C" key.  Then use the disk utility program, in the utilities menu, to do a secure erase of the hard drive.  This will prevent whoever buys the machine from retrieving your personal data off the machine after you sell it.  A seven-pass wipe is considered secure by the US government, and should be more than adequate for your use.  If you're truly paranoid, do a 35-pass wipe...and expect to spend a few day waiting for it it finish running.</description>
